Methods to Check Your Passport Application Status in Kenya
There are several ways to check your Passport Application Status Kenya. Here are a few methods you can use:
- Online Portal: You can check your passport application status online through the e-Citizen portal. Simply log in to your account, click on the “Passport Application” tab, and follow the instructions.
- Mobile Phone: You can also check your passport application status via SMS. Send a message with your application number to 2032, and you’ll receive an update on your application status.
- Immigration Office: You can visit the nearest immigration office or the Department of Immigration Services in Nairobi to inquire about your passport application status.
What to Expect During the Passport Application Process
The passport application process in Kenya typically takes 10-15 working days. Here’s an overview of what you can expect:
- Submission of Application: You submit your passport application and supporting documents.
- Verification: The immigration department verifies your documents and conducts background checks.
- Approval: Your application is approved, and your passport is printed.
- Courier Delivery: Your passport is delivered to you via courier services.
Common Issues That May Delay Your Passport Application
Sometimes, your passport application may be delayed due to various reasons. Here are some common issues that may cause delays:
- Incomplete or inaccurate application forms
- Insufficient or missing documents
- Background checks or security clearance issues
- High volume of applications

How long does it take to process a passport application in Kenya?
The processing time for a passport application in Kenya can take anywhere from 6 to 8 weeks, depending on the workload of the Kenya Immigration Department. What documents do I need to submit with my passport application?
To apply for a passport in Kenya, you’ll need to provide a valid form of identification, a copy of your birth certificate, a passport-sized photograph, and proof of Kenyan citizenship. Can I apply for an emergency passport in Kenya?
Yes, the Kenya Immigration Department offers an emergency passport service for urgent travel situations. You’ll need to provide proof of emergency travel, such as a flight itinerary or a letter from your employer.
